Calling the flop is definitely an option Paluka. You are not very scared of free cards because if Deer had a naked draw he wouldnt make this raise(I dont think he would atleast...is my thinking off?).
He either has a combo draw he is ready to get it in with or no draw at all. U might convince him to play the turn incorrectly if u just call (I guess this depends a lot on history). A likely hand for Deer here is QQ-KK (unfortunately JJ also) if u just call there is a much better chance he gets more money in there with those hands. |

i just call. then get it in on nearly any turn. 45dd is the only combo-ish thing out, so we are either crushing his range or he flopped a set. this is wa/wb, and we aren't releasing it to this guy, so let's get the hook set.
